The concept sections of this book primarily require knowledge of calculus, though some require an understanding of probability (think maximum likelihood and Bayes’ Rule) and basic linear algebra (think matrix operations and dot products). Mastering Machine Learning Algorithms including Neural Networks with Numpy, Pandas, Matplotlib, Seaborn and Scikit-Learn. This makes machine learning well-suited to the present-day era of Big Data and Data Science. The purpose of this book is to provide those derivations. both in theory and math. Welcome to another installment of these weekly KDnuggets free eBook overviews. It’s second edition has recently been published, upgrading and improving the content of … Machine Learning For Absolute Beginners, 2nd Edition has been written and designed for absolute beginners. Year: 2018. (Source: Derivation in concept and code, dafriedman97.github.io/mlbook/content/introduction.html). It’s a classic O’Reilly book and is the perfect form factor to have open in front of you while you bash away at the keyboard implementing the code examples. Hands-On Machine Learning with Scikit-Learn and TensorFlow: Concepts, Tools, and Techniques to Build Intelligent Systems “By using concrete examples, minimal theory, and two production-ready Python frameworks—scikit-learn and TensorFlow—author Aurélien Géron helps you gain an intuitive understanding of the concepts and tools for building intelligent systems. Machine Learning From Scratch: Part 2. It does not review best practices—such as feature engineering or balancing response variables—or discuss in depth when certain models are more appropriate than others. You've successfully signed in Success! 3 people found this helpful. Ordinary Linear Regression Concept Construction Implementation 2. Each chapter in this book corresponds to a single machine learning method or group of methods. Introduction Table of Contents Conventions and Notation 1. It provides step-by-step tutorials on how to implement top algorithms as well as how to load data, evaluate models and more. In my experience, the best way to become comfortable with these methods is to see them derived from scratch, both in theory and in code. repository open issue suggest edit. Authors: Shai Shalev-Shwartz and Shai Ben-David. By Danny Friedman Machine Learning: The New AI focuses on basic Machine Learning, ranging from the evolution to important learning algorithms and their example applications. Read reviews from world’s largest community for readers. The author Ethem Alpaydin is a well-known scholar in the field who also published Introduction to Machine Learning. Book Description “What I cannot create, I do not understand” – Richard Feynman This book is your guide on your journey to deeper Machine Learning understanding by developing algorithms from scratch. - curiousily/Machine-Learning-from-Scratch If you are only curious about what is machine learning and you only want to read a book on machine learning one time in life (yes, only one time in life), you can buy it but I believe it wastes your money! Book Name: Python Machine Learning. Neural Network From Scratch with NumPy and MNIST. This book covers the building blocks of the most common methods in machine learning. Deep Learning from Scratch. Amazon.in - Buy Machine Learning For Absolute Beginners: A Plain English Introduction: 1 (Machine Learning from Scratch) book online at best prices in India on Amazon.in. Machine Learning For Absolute Beginners, 2nd Edition has been written and designed for absolute beginners. The book provides complete derivations of the most common algorithms in ML (OLS, logistic regression, naive Bayes, trees, boosting, neural nets, etc.) The aim of this textbook is to introduce machine learning, and the algorithmic paradigms it offers, in a princi-pled way. Python Machine Learning from Scratch book. This book will guide you on your journey to deeper Machine Learning understanding by developing algorithms in Python from scratch! Machine Learning from Scratch-ish. This book gives a structured introduction to machine learning. Ahmed Ph. From Book 1: ... is designed for readers taking their first steps in machine learning and further learning will be required beyond this book to master machine learning. Those entering the field of machine learning should feel comfortable with this toolbox so they have the right tool for a variety of tasks. The implementation sections demonstrate how to apply the methods using packages in Python like scikit-learn, statsmodels, and tensorflow. Chapter 3: Visualizin… Succinct Machine Learning algorithm implementations from scratch in Python, solving real-world problems (Notebooks and Book). Chapter 2: A Crash Course in Python(syntax, data structures, control flow, and other features) 3. Best machine learning books - these are the best machine learning books in my opinion. Python Machine Learning for Beginners: Learning from Scratch Numpy, Pandas, Matplotlib, Seaborn, SKlearn and TensorFlow 2.0 for Machine Learning & Deep Learning- With Exercises and Hands-on Projects | Publishing, AI | download | Z-Library. Succinct Machine Learning algorithm implementations from scratch in Python, solving real-world problems (Notebooks and Book). This set of methods is like a toolbox for machine learning engineers. The book is 311 pages long and contains 25 chapters. This is perhaps the newest book in this whole article and it’s listed for good reason. Contents 1. Seeing these derivations might help a reader previously unfamiliar with common algorithms understand how they work intuitively. Word counts. Free delivery on qualified orders. ... a new word is introduced on every line of the book and the book is, thus, more suitable for … Taking you from the basics of machine learning to complex applications such as image and text analysis, each new project builds on what you’ve learned in previous chapters. Learn why and when Machine learning is the right tool for the job and how to improve low performing models! Free delivery on qualified orders. If you are considering going into Machine Learning and Data Science, this book is a great first step. In this section we take a look at the table of contents: 1. Read reviews from world’s largest community for readers. I learned a lot from it, from Unsupervised Learning algorithms like K-Means Clustering, to Supervised Learning ones like XGBoost’s Boosted Trees.. Are the best machine learning from scratch. readers looking to learn New machine learning method or group of is! @ dafrdman ) means plain-English explanations and visual examples are added to make a bright career in the field machine! The ML toolbox weekly KDnuggets free eBook overviews books in my opinion work and study the resurgence machine learning from scratch book neural with! Books on machine learning and neural networks with numpy, Pandas, Matplotlib, Seaborn and Scikit-Learn Principles Python! Computer Science, this book covers the building blocks of the book is to readers! A deeper level classes in Python using only numpy low performing models depth when certain are. Python from scratch to machine learning algorithms work above in the book.pdf file above in appendix. Book is called machine learning well-suited to the present-day era of Big and. Seth Weidman with the resurgence of neural networks with numpy, Pandas, Matplotlib, and. Linkedin here is one of the deep learning from scratch in Python, solving real-world problems ( Notebooks book... Beginners - data management and analytics for approaching deep learning has become essential for machine.! Learn why and when machine learning understanding by developing algorithms in Python using numpy. Largest community for readers looking to learn from these datasets can also connect with me on Twitter here email... Data sets and helps programmers write codes to learn New machine learning, other. Is how to load data, evaluate models and more me, now..., finally cut through the math and probabilityneeded to understand checkout for full to! On machine learning is probably the best machine learning engineers • 18 min read greatest... Me at dafrdman @ gmail.com can raise an issue here or email me at dafrdman @ gmail.com of work study. The buzzword in the master branch listed for good reason … the book “ machine learning should feel comfortable this! Of data Science from scratch. algorithms independently Joel Grus understanding machine learning the! Principles by Seth Weidman with the PDF can be found in the book.pdf file above in the master.. To deeper machine learning machine learning engineers which is probably the most common methods in machine learning work... Book Description: how can a beginner approach machine learning should feel comfortable with toolbox! Weidman with the ability to construct these algorithms independently an issue here or email me at dafrdman @.... 311 pages long and contains 25 chapters implement top algorithms as well their results mathematically … book to low! A beginner approach machine learning understanding by developing algorithms in Python using only numpy learn and. Is machine learning Python like Scikit-Learn, statsmodels, and other features ) 3 About machine learning book ’! Probably the most comprehensive machine learning is the most common methods in machine.! Branch of machine learning book Description: how can a beginner approach machine learning: the AI... Are considering going into machine learning is the right tool for the job and how to transform into... Cut through the math and learn exactly how machine learning written by more knowledgeable authors and a! The field of machine learning entire marketplace, with far-reaching applications tutorial on elements... Finally cut through the math and probabilityneeded to understand practice in basic modeling book 1: Introduction ( What data. Those with practice in basic modeling: 1 by MailChimp from these... Are introduced, clear explanations, simple pure Python code ( no libraries machine learning from scratch book of. Introduction to machine learning should feel comfortable with this toolbox so they have the right tool for the job how. There are many machine learning from scratch book books on machine learning engineers PDF creation to along... It ’ s largest community for readers ( Notebooks and book ) or useful for readers published Introduction to learning! And code sections of this textbook is to provide readers with the ability to construct the methods from scratch Python... Processed by MailChimp you do n't really understand something until you can implement it from (! Probably the best learning exercise you can implement it from scratch using.! Found in the entire marketplace, with far-reaching applications implementations from scratch. it is for! Easy and engaging to follow along at home algorithms understand how they work intuitively... Powered Jupyter. Networks with numpy, Pandas, Matplotlib, Seaborn and Scikit-Learn applied machine learning algorithms derived from to! Important advanced architectures machine learning from scratch book implementing everything from scratch – the book is called machine learning work! Using packages in Python from scratch. … book data scientists and software engineers with machine learning -! Derivations that transform these concepts into practical algorithms dafrdman ) in basic.... Understand algorithms at a deeper level comprehensive and self-contained tutorial on the most comprehensive machine learning understanding by developing in! Listed for good reason `` machine learning: the New AI looks into the algorithms used on sets. Bookcamp, you do n't really understand something until you can build neural networks without the help of book. Greatest posts delivered straight to your inbox topics in applied machine learning should feel comfortable with this toolbox so have! Approaching deep learning and neural networks with numpy, Pandas, Matplotlib, Seaborn and.! Of `` 7 books About machine learning should feel comfortable with this toolbox so they have the right tool a. A variety of tasks get all the important machine learning experience, Seaborn and Scikit-Learn with the resurgence of networks. Science, with far-reaching applications for those with practice in basic modeling …!, clear explanations, simple pure Python code ( no libraries! checkout for full to! Found so far this makes machine learning: the New AI focuses a!